Step 1
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F. Coat a 9" x 13" pan with cooking spray.
Step 2
Melt 1 tablespoon of the butter in a large pan over medium heat. Add the sausage and cook for 5-6 minutes or until done, breaking up the meat with a spatula.
Step 3
Add the remaining 7 tablespoons of butter, onion and celery to the pan. Cook for an additional 4-5 minutes or until vegetables are tender.
Step 4
Add the garlic and cook for 30 seconds.
Step 5
Place the bread cubes in a large bowl. Add the sausage mixture, chicken broth, eggs, sage, parsley and salt and pepper to the bowl.
Step 6
Gently stir until everything is well combined. Pour the stuffing into the prepared pan.
Step 7
Bake for 60 minutes. If the top starts to get overly browned before the cooking time is over, then cover the pan with foil.
Step 8
Remove from the oven. Sprinkle with additional parsley, then serve.
